Water damage can be a nightmare for homeowners in Seattle, WA, given the city's rainy climate. Understanding the cost of water damage renovation is crucial for proper planning and budgeting. This guide breaks down the factors affecting the cost and provides an overview of common tasks and their average costs.

Factors Affecting Cost

  • Extent of Damage: The severity of the water damage significantly impacts the overall cost. Minor leaks cost less to repair than extensive flooding.
  • Type of Water: Clean water from a broken pipe is cheaper to clean up than contaminated water from a sewer backup.
  • Area Affected: Costs can vary depending on whether the damage is confined to a small area or spread across multiple rooms.
  • Materials Needed: The type and quantity of materials required for renovation, such as drywall, insulation, and flooring, influence the cost.
  • Labor Costs: Labor rates in Seattle can vary, affecting the overall renovation cost.
  • Mold Remediation: If mold is present, additional costs for mold removal and treatment will apply.
  • Permits and Inspections: Some renovations may require permits and inspections, adding to the overall cost.

Average Costs for Common Tasks

Task Average Cost (Seattle, WA)
Water Extraction $500 - $2,000
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 - $3,000
Mold Remediation $500 - $4,000
Drywall Repair $500 - $1,500
Flooring Replacement $1,000 - $4,000
Plumbing Repairs $300 - $1,200
Electrical Repairs $200 - $1,000
Structural Repairs $2,000 - $10,000

Understanding these factors and average costs can help Seattle homeowners better prepare for water damage renovation, ensuring they can restore their homes efficiently and effectively.
